How We Calculate Calories Burned for Gardening in Baton Rouge
Our calculator uses the standard MET (Metabolic Equivalent of Task) formula with a local climate adjustment for Baton Rouge:
Calories = MET × Weight (kg) × Duration (hrs) × Climate Factor
= 3.8 × Weight (kg) × Duration (hrs) × 1.00
The MET value of 3.8 for gardening is sourced from the Compendium of Physical Activities. The climate factor of 1.00 accounts for Baton Rouge's average temperature of 65°F. Research shows that exercising in non-neutral temperatures increases energy expenditure as the body works to maintain its core temperature.
Gardening involves a variety of physical activities including digging, planting, weeding, raking, and carrying supplies. These movements engage upper body, core, and lower body muscles through natural functional patterns. Gardening provides moderate-intensity physical activity that has been shown to reduce stress, improve mood, and provide vitamin D from sun exposure. Studies show that regular gardeners have lower BMI, better dietary habits, and reduced risk of chronic disease compared to non-gardeners.
